Understanding the Mechanism Underlying Vaccination for Alzheimer’s Disease

Evidence is accumulating that vaccination against a variety of different pathogens can reduce the risk of Alzheimer’s disease (AD). The vaccines now include:  the Bacillus Calmette-Guérin (BCG) vaccine, a 100-year-old anti-tuberculosis vaccine; the triple vaccine of childhood (DPT); anti-tetanus or anti-diphtheria vaccination alone; anti-influenza; anti-pneumonia; and possibly anti-shingles, currently “under review.” The ...

Understanding the Cell Biology Underlying the Effects of Abeta on Synapse

This research will attempt to understand the following central cell biological questions: What is the sub-cellular site where Aβ is secreted? Can the effects of Aβ secretion on synapses be blocked by drugs? Preliminary data show that overproduction of either axonal or dendritic Aβ reduces spine density and plasticity at dendrites close (~ ...
